Taormina is
a hill-village with a glossy sheen of glamour. A drink at the tables of Caffè
Wunderbar (or similar) in Piazza IX Aprile may set you back a few euros, but
you'll be basking where Tennessee Williams and Elizabeth Taylor basked before
you. As
well as the famed Greek-Roman Theatre (Admission Fee: not included), there are
several minor sites to be discovered around Taormina. The attractive principal
thoroughfare, Corso Umberto is pedestrian and ideal for strolling and
window-shopping. Picturesque lanes above and below the Corso are interesting to
explore, while if you want to stretch your legs further there are attractive
walks up into the hills, or down to the sea. Given its compact size, Taormina
has a huge range of bars, cafes and restaurants where you can while away
pleasant hours while admiring the views.

Day 3 (Thursday) Taormina/Syracuse/Taormina
Today we depart for
Syracuse, founded by colonists from Cornith in 735 B.C. and once the most
important competitor to Athens. On arrival stroll through the streets of
Ortygia Island, the heart of the city center. Light lunch at local
restaurant. This afternoon visit through the Archaeological Park (Admission
Fee: not included) highlights the Greek Theatre, the Roman Amphitheatre and
the Paradise Quarry. Later we return to Taormina.

Day 4
(Friday) Taormina/Piazza Armerina/Palermo
Today departure for
Piazza Armerina to view the ruins of the Roman Villa of Casale (Admission
Fee: not included). The mosaics discovered here are celebrated among
scholars of antiquity. Light lunch in a local trattoria. This afternoon we
continue to Palermo, the capital of Sicily.

Day 5
(Saturday) Palermo/Erice, Olive Oil, Segesta & Winery/Palermo
Early departure to
tour western Sicily where we reach Erice uptown. The Elymians settled the
medieval town of Erice, which was an important religious site associated
with the goddess Venus. Wander through its ancient streets and visit some of the
famous homemade pastry shops—world-famous for marzipan candies and other
delicacies like almond and pistachio pastries. Later we travel to Trapani on the
Salt Way Road. We tour the historic salt flats works, where the ancient
tradition of harvesting salt from the sea is still practiced. Then, to an olive
oil factory-farmhouse to enjoy a light lunch. This afternoon we continue onto
Segesta, one of the major cities of the ancient
indigenous Elymian people, to visit the
unfinished Doric temple (Admission Fee: not
included), late 5th century BC, built on a hilltop
just outside of the ancient city and has a commanding view of the surrounding
area. Then to a local winery to taste Sicilian
wine. We then return to Palermo. (BB L)
Day 6 (Sunday) Palermo, Cefalù & Monreale
Today we explore the
lively Capo Market,
a large open air street market
that captures the flavor of Palermo's Saracen Arab past. Capo is a blend of
general confusion and a jumble of vendors' stalls, winding toward the old gate
--Porta Carini-- of what used to be the city wall. Later we continue by seeing
Piazza Pretoria and Via Maqueda, whose “four corners” converge Palermo at
a quartet of baroque palaces left over from the heyday of Spanish rule dating
from 1560. We then departure for Cefalù,
a charming coastal town home to a massive Norman Cathedral with outstanding
mosaics. Here we visit the city center and stroll down main street to reach the
Cathedral. This afternoon onto
Monreale
to see where the Arab-Norman art and
architecture reached the pinnacle of its glory with the Duomo (Admission Fee:
not included), launched in 1174 by William II. It represents scenes from the
Old and New Testaments all in golden mosaics.
Later we return to Palermo (BB)
